Metrics and convergence in moduli spaces of maps

Abstract: We provide a general framework to study convergence properties of families of maps. For manifolds and where is equipped with a volume form we consider families of maps in the collection and we define a distance function similar to the distance on such a collection. The definition of depends on several parameters, but we show that the properties and topology of the metric space do not depend on these choices. In particular we show that the metric space is always complete. After exploring the properties of we shift our focus to exploring the convergence properties of families of such maps.
